Chapter 34 - The Birth of a Monster ep17 s3

As the blood of his mother seeped into the cracks of the grand hall's marble floor, something inside the 7th Prince shattered beyond repair.

His breathing was slow, steady—but his soul twisted into something unrecognizable. The warm boy who once dreamed of proving himself to his family was now nothing more than a hollow shell, filled with nothing but hatred and cold calculation.

The Emperor turned, dismissing the scene as though it were insignificant. The nobles whispered among themselves, some entertained, others disturbed.

The 2nd Prince, still gripping his bloodstained sword, approached his younger brother and leaned in.

"Still standing, little brother?" he whispered mockingly. "I expected you to break like a child, but you're stronger than I thought."

The 7th Prince didn't react. His face was completely void of emotion.

The 2nd Prince smirked. "Mother's screams were quite something, weren't they? If only you had knelt and begged, maybe I would've let her live."

Silence.

But the 7th Prince's gaze slowly lifted—and for the first time, the 2nd Prince felt a chill creep down his spine.

There was no sorrow. No rage. No grief.

Just emptiness.

And then, a whisper.

"One day, you will kneel."

The 2nd Prince's smirk faltered for the briefest moment.

The hall's heavy doors creaked open, and Grandmaster Leo Chang entered, his brows furrowed as he took in the bloody scene. His piercing gaze flickered to his disciple.

But the boy he once knew was gone.

The 7th Prince turned away from his mother's corpse, his robes brushing against her lifeless hand. He didn't even spare her a final glance.

He simply walked away, his steps eerily calm, controlled.

From that day forward, the 7th Prince ceased to exist.

What remained…

Was a monster with no heart, no weakness, and no mercy.
